Transaction 2f44ae1694133ce9330145859b9879e2c74c9dc280c7d8816cfb4970820d6563
1 Input
2 Outputs
- 2f44ae1694133ce9330145859b9879e2c74c9dc280c7d8816cfb4970820d6563:0
- 2f44ae1694133ce9330145859b9879e2c74c9dc280c7d8816cfb4970820d6563:1
value 3081584670
address 1A4BdAFUTFWp6BFfWaeZnTzdQst8D28V7V
value 18515435
address 1A2RFVz4xEmvRUBiAHG5WzjecbNbUiL4HM